What is a Plexiglass Laser Cutter?
A plexiglass laser cutter is a precision tool designed to cut and engrave materials using a focused laser beam. Unlike traditional cutting methods that rely on mechanical tools, this machine uses light to make precise incisions. The laser heats the material to its melting point, vaporizing it or creating intricate designs on the surface.
This technology is highly versatile and can work with various materials, including plexiglass, metal, plastic, wood, and even leather. Its ability to handle different materials makes it a valuable asset for industries such as manufacturing, signage, furniture making, and custom.
How does it work? The machine uses a laser generator to produce high-energy light beams. These beams are directed through mirrors or lenses to focus on the material’s surface. As the laser hits the material, it either melts, burns, or vaporizes it, creating clean cuts or engravings.

Maintenance and Safety Tips
To maximize the lifespan and performance of your plexiglass laser cutter, follow these tips:
- Regular Cleaning: Keep the machine’s optics and surfaces clean to ensure optimal laser performance.
- Proper Ventilation: Use in a well-ventilated area to avoid inhaling harmful fumes produced during cutting.
- Safety Gear: Always wear protective eyewear and gloves when operating the machine.
